Guide to Disaster Recovery Capitals (ReCap)

A framework of ‘community capitals’ – natural, social, financial, cultural, political, built and human.

What is this about?

This guide is for people, organisations and governments engaged in disaster recovery. It aims to support wellbeing after disasters by providing evidence-based guidance to aid decision-making, encouraging strengths-based, holistic and inclusive approaches to recovery.
